New safeguarding training launched by St John Ambulance Cymru

We have recently launched a new Safeguarding Group B course!

The course is designed for anyone who has regular contact with adults, children, or members of the public.

It aims to help delegates gain the knowledge and confidence to recognise and respond to safeguarding concerns. It combines online pre-course learning with a face-to-face training day. On successful completion, delegates will receive a Safeguarding Group B certificate.

Safeguarding is crucial in the UK, as it protects vulnerable individuals from abuse, harm and neglect. It is becoming increasingly complex, due to rising numbers of reported concerns, evolving forms of risk and increased pressure on professionals. This has led us to introduce this new course.

This addition to our training portfolio is particularly exciting as it expands our courses beyond first aid, mental health, and health and safety training to include safeguarding for the first time.
